Was ist Handcodierung?
Handcodierung ist eine Programmier- und Codierungstechnik, bei der der Benutzer den gesamten Code manuell ausgibt. Wenn ein Benutzer eine Website oder ein Programm erstellt, kann er oder sie entweder Code von Hand Code oder einen Generator verwenden - oft als ein so bezeichnetes Editor des (WYSIWYG). Ein Vorteil für die Handcodierung ist ein kleinerer Codierungs -Fußabdruck, der dazu führt, dass Websites und Programme schnell und sauber geladen werden. Die meisten Jobs, die Programmierer einstellen, erfordern, dass sie wissen, wie sie Code von Hand bringen können, da einige Generatoren in Bezug auf Funktionen eingeschränkt sind. Die Nachteile der manuellen Codierung einer Website oder eines Programms sind, dass es länger dauert und es eine Lernkurve gibt. Bei der Handcodierung tippt der Benutzer alles manuell aus. Der gesamte Code wird von Hand in einen Texteditor eingegeben. Wenn ein Generator verwendet wird, erstellt der Generator automatisch einen großen Teil des Codes. Zum Beispiel, wenn der Programmierer ein Bild auf a platzieren möchteWebsite, er oder sie kann das Bild einfach im Generator öffnen, und der Generator erstellt die gesamte Codierung, die erforderlich ist, um das Bild auf der Website zu befestigen.
Der Hauptvorteil für die Handcodierung ist ein kleiner Codierungs -Fußabdruck. Wenn ein Generator verwendet wird, wird häufig zusätzlichen Code erstellt. Einige Generatoren fügen identifizierende Code hinzu, sodass andere Benutzer wissen, welchen Generator die Website oder das Programm erstellt hat. Andere Generatoren fügen zusätzlichen Code hinzu, um mehrere Jahre Codierungsstandards gleichzeitig zu erfüllen. Daher können Personen mit früheren Internetbrowsern oder Betriebssystemen die Website oder das Programm weiterhin verwenden. Dies ist jedoch in der Regel unnötig. Eine handcodierte Website oder ein Programm wird in der Regel viel weniger codieren, sodass die Ladezeiten viel schneller sind. Die Codierung lädt auch Reiniger, was bedeutet, dass ein Teil des Programms oder einer Website weniger eine Chance besteht
Wenn ein ProgrammR sucht nach einer Karriere beim Aufbau von Programmen oder Websites. Generatoren sind normalerweise in der Lage, Code ziemlich gut zu manipulieren und zu erstellen, aber Generatoren können erweiterte Codierungsprobleme möglicherweise nicht beheben. Das Kennen der Handcodierung erfordert auch mehr Codierungskenntnisse, wodurch der Programmierer in der Codierungssprache geschickter wird.
Es gibt zwei Hauptnachteile für die Handcodierung: Zeit und Wissen. Das Erstellen einer Website oder eines Programms von Grund auf kann Stunden oder Tage länger dauern als die Verwendung eines Generators. Handkodierprogrammierer müssen auch über gute Kenntnisse der Codierungssprache verfügen. Andernfalls müssen sie häufig die Codierungsreferenzen überprüfen, während sie die Website oder das Programm erstellen.